Chess Puzzle #0uEi3 — Beginner, White to move, middlegame

Rating 1183 · Beginner · advanced pawn, mate, mate in 1, middlegame, one move.

Position

White: king g1; queen d5; rook a1; knight b5; pawns a2/a6/c4/g3/h2. Black: king a7; queen e2; rooks d8/h8; bishop c8; knight d1; pawns b6/c7/d6/e4/g6/h7. Black is ahead by 9 points of material. White to move.

Solution (1 move)

  1. Opponent setup: Kb8 — king a7→b8. Now White to move.
  2. Best move: a7# — pawn a6→a7, delivers checkmate.

Tactical themes

advanced pawn, mate, mate in 1, middlegame, one move. The combination ends with a7# delivering checkmate.
